  • Patent number: 4810993
    Abstract: An electromechanical component, in particular a rotary potentiometer having an integrated center click or optionally more fixed intermediate positions. The fixed intermediate position is obtained by a combination of two teeth and a lug. The two teeth are integrated with the element of the resistance path and the lug with the element having the contact members of the component.

  • Patent number: 4665464
    Abstract: An adjustable electromechanical device, such as a potentiometer, a variable capacitor or a multiple switch, comprising a shaft which is rotatably mounted in a sleeve. The shaft is retained in the axial direction by an annular wall portion of the bearing sleeve at the free end of the sleeve, the annular wall portion is spaced from the remainder of the sleeve by at least one but preferably two evenly distributed slots which extend circumferentially in the wall of the sleeve. The annular wall portion remains connnected to the remainder of the bearing sleeve at at least one location. The free parts of the annular portion are deformed to engage a circumferential groove in the shaft.
